Job description

Certis is a leading outsourced services partner that designs, builds and operates smart, integrated solutions across security, facilities management and customer experience. Headquartered in Singapore with a growing presence in Australia and Qatar, we harness the power of technology, from AI to robotics, to deliver critical services that protect lives and enable communities to thrive.At Certis, your work has purpose. You will be part of a mission that goes beyond operations and shapes safer, smarter and better outcomes for people and businesses. We offer diverse career pathways, invest in your growth and empower you to make a meaningful difference.If you are ready to build the future, your journey starts here with us.

Duties & Responsibilities
  • Have the opportunity to develop knowledge and gain exposure across a wide array of functions / business units in Certis
  • Build the knowledge, insights, and understanding of business operations, digital tools and processes, analys[ing] the information/data available to facilitate decision‑making in the business unit / team
  • Prepare for internal (business units, board) and external (potential clients) meetings, which includes drafting of presentation decks, research, and proposals, , attending and presenting in meetings, and handling follow‑ups in assigned areas of work
  • Evaluate and coordinate assigned projects, including special projects - formulation, research, evaluation and implementation, as well as managing project prioritisation in a dynamic working environment
  • Build and develop relationships within and across teams, departments and business units for increased efficiency and to gain insights on how to execute existing operations and processes, but also help to define process improvements, working closely with your peers, people manager and senior management leaders
Skills & Experience
  • Fresh graduate / young professional with no more than 2 years of full‑time work experience
  • Minimum Honours Degree with Distinction / High Merit or equivalent
  • Is interested in and curious about the security industry, and demonstrates savviness in technological skills (analytics, basic coding etc.)
  • Possess open‑mindedness and an ability to deal with a wide‑ranging set of priorities and projects; be resourceful enough to find acceptable solutions to problems regardless of subject matter
  • Ability to grasp new concepts, acquire new ways of seeing things, and revise ways of thinking and behaving, with a strong process‑improvement mindset
